Can I apply for an Ecuador visa from my home country without travelling?
Much of the document preparation can be done from abroad — gathering records, apostilles, translations, and completing the online eVISAS application. However, some visa categories require an in-person appointment or fingerprinting in Ecuador. The exact requirements change and depend on the visa type, your nationality, and current Cancillería workflow. Some applicants enter Ecuador on a tourist stamp, complete the in-person steps, and remain while the visa processes. Others coordinate through Ecuadorian consulates abroad, though consulate services vary significantly by location. Verify the current channel requirements for your specific visa category before planning travel.
